How Interviews and Applicant Tracking Systems Are Changing

Job hunters refer to “the black hole” where their resume goes in and nothing comes out. Employers dislike that they are bombarded with more resumes than they can reasonably handle. They know that the 999th resume received is likely not to be responded to as well as the 1st if at all.
